The Value Of Nasal Airflow Evaluation In The Surgery For The Nasal Septal Deviation

Objective To evaluate the state of nasal airflow in patients with nasal septal deviation.To evaluate the effect of nasal septal surgery with nasal objective examination.To compare the results of objective examination with subjective feeling.To investigate the value of objective nasal airflow evaluation in the surgery for nasal septal deviation.Methods 1.One hundred and ten patients with nasal septal deviation were randomly recruited.Nasal spirometry was used to get the volume of airflow in each side nasal cavity(VL,VR) and nasal partitioning of airflow ratio(NPR).The data was analyzed to get the common characteristics;2.AR,RM and NS were used in fifty-one patients who prepared for surgery of nasal septal deviation.Each patient was tested before and twelve weeks after surgery;3.Record the data of nasal airway resistance(NAR),nasal caity volume of 0-5cm(NCV0-5),nasal minimal cross-sectional area(NMCA) and nasal partitioning of airflow ratio (NPR);4.Visual analogue scale(VAS) was used to estimate the degree of subjective feeling of nasal obstruction.The results were analyzed to investigate the correlation between the results of objective examination and the results of VAS.Results 1.NS emamination shows that the results are VL:1.656±0.769L,VR: 1.536±0.716L.Analyzed with Spss16.0,most of the data is between 0.5 to 2.5L. There is no significant difference between VL and VR(p>0.05).NPR: 0.280±0.254,seventy-three patients NPR are between 0 to 0.3 and only twelve patients NPR are more than 0.6;2.AR test results:The preoperative data is NCV0-5:4.07±0.91cm3 NMCA:0.33±0.08cm2,and the postoperative data is NCV0-5:7.29±0.68 cm3 NMCA:0.56±0.08 cm2.Significant difference is shown between the data preoperative and postoperative(p<0.01).The NCV and NMCA data is increased by surgery;3.RM test results:The preoperative data is NAR: 1.140±0.336 kPa·s·L-1 and the postoperative data is NAR:0.345±0.117 kPa·s·L-1, suggesting significant difference(p<0.01).NAR decreased to the normal level postoperatively;4.NS test results:The preoperative data is NPR:0.53±0.22 and the postoperative data is NPR:0.18±0.12.Significant difference is shown between the data preoperative and postoperative(p<0.01).This means that the difference in airflow between left and right nasal cavity airflow decreased by the surgery;5. VAS test results:The preoperative data is VAS:7.36±1.23 and the postoperative data is VAS:1.14±0.91.Significant difference is shown between the data preoperative and postoperative(p<0.01).The average of VAS decreased more than 6.Conclusions Objective examination of nasal airflow can help us to evaluate the state of nasal septal deviation in patients before surgery.It also can evaluate the effect of surgery treatment.Therefore,the objective examination of nasal airflow could be used as effective method for doctors in surgery selection and effect evaluation.
